Description For Software Development Engineer, Transportation Cost Allocation and Accounting

Join Amazon's Transportation Financial Systems (TFS) team to build cutting-edge solutions for transportation cost allocation and accounting. This role offers a unique opportunity to work on high-impact engineering challenges in a fast-paced environment. You'll be responsible for developing the platform that accurately reflects the economics of Amazon's global transportation network.

The role involves building complex algorithms using mathematics and machine learning to allocate transportation costs to shipped items, directly impacting Amazon's profitability calculations and business charging mechanisms. You'll work with a team of 100+ engineers across eight different platforms, handling billions of dollars in automated spend.

As part of TFS, you'll build highly scalable systems that serve as the authority for ship cost computation at Amazon. The position offers collaboration with global product teams and economists to develop sophisticated cost models. The engineering team is based in India but builds global solutions for Amazon's transportation network.

The role requires strong technical skills in building high-volume, low-latency services that handle thousands of requests per second. You'll work with cutting-edge technologies in big data, machine learning, and real-time analytics.
